So, 'Nakawin Natin Ang Bawat Sandali' is this intriguing little gem from 1978 that really pulls you in with its raw emotional weight. It's about two lovers gripping onto fleeting moments of passion in a world that seems against them. The pacing is a bit languid at times, almost as if it’s trying to stretch those stolen seconds into something more meaningful. You get this palpable tension that hangs in the air, and the performances—while perhaps not technically flawless—have a sincerity that really resonates. There's something distinctive about the way it captures that desperate need for connection, almost like the film itself is a secret to be shared among those who appreciate the nuances of love in adversity. It’s not just a love story; it’s a study of time and its relentless passage, wrapped in a quiet atmosphere that stays with you.
This film has seen limited release formats over the years, with VHS tapes being the most common find among collectors. It rarely surfaces in good condition, adding to its allure. Interest in the film has grown due to its unique perspective on love and time, leading to a small but dedicated following among those who appreciate classic cinema that treads into more obscure territory.
